Cardinals OC drops intriguing Jeremiyah Love Takeaway
Joe Camporeale-Imagn Images

The Arizona Cardinals are attempting to spark excitement despite not knowing who’ll be Mike LaFleur’s quarterback. What’s inevitable is Jeremiyah Love will get the football. Leading to offensive coordinator Nathaniel Hackett to drop an intriguing take ahead of NFL Training Camp.

Yet Hackett didn’t come across as a coach glorifying the prized NFL Draft selection. He instead namedropped another running back. 

“I’m really excited about it. Excited for James [Conner] to get out there and show what he’s got. I mean, all the guys,” Hackett said. “Right now, we’re trying to work on that operation

But as for Love, Hackett simply said: “He’s a definitely a rookie. And he’ll keep growing every single day.”

That can interpret as Hackett sill needing to see more from the former Notre Dame star. This despite landing as the No. 3 overall pick. Or, the former Denver Broncos head coach simply is being mum of giving too much away of Love’s potential.

The offense became stagnant under the previous regime, fueling the Love pick. Arizona turned more to a defensive identity with Jonathan Gannon as the head coach. Ultimately Arizona struggled to gain any offensive footing and relied more on trusting Conner, even over former quarterback Kyler Murray.

So LaFleur’s hire is expected to inject new life into that side of the ball. Especially as someone who spent time working with distinguished offensive minds Kyle Shanahan and Sean McVay with the San Francisco 49ers and Los Angeles Rams, respectively. Love and Conner will be needed to ease the tensions of finding a permanent starting QB.
